These party originating from the 15th century, became popular from 1945. The main events of the same is the picturesque procession of the Pregó, announcing the festivities; the procession of the Canyes to the hermitage of Santa María Magdalena; the night procession of the Retorno, with the image of the Crucification of the Pure Blood , and the procession of the 'gaiatas', that are 'tejos' and crooks with polychromatic illumination.

The gaiata, become one of the symbols representing the tradition, because it says that on the day that people decided to go down to the plain Castellon, was a day of rain or bad weather, which by the way were asked by night and, to not miss, hikers decided to put a lantern on the end of a rod that will light the way

Gaiatas, geographically distributed throughout the city to a number of 19, are grouped around a neighborhood. And all his people. They have been and continue sienso one of the key column systems of social integration, which has allowed the party to incorporate a lot of outsiders.

The highlight of the life of the bagpipe is when, at night, with the arrival of people from the chapel of the Magdalene, commission parades through the streets of the city.

Behind each gaiata marches the band playing the popular official song Rotllo i Canya almost nonstop.

The holiday week can be divided into three basic parts. On the one hand we have the first weekend with Pregó, Magdalena going to the parade and bagpipes. During the rest of the days in which most people take vacation or Castellón, at least half a day off, the festivities are concentrated in the afternoon: the views and acts of Collas and commissions explode with music , varied meals and entertainment

The third part is the second weekend. This focus again some acts. And the most important is the parade ellso and the final fireworks (with thousands of people running from the fire and smoke) that runs through the main streets of the city sight to see and still not well known except by the natives. Castle Fire "Magdalena Vitol" concludes the week
